Transaction 51608792ad2154ea62c07582cb596e9a7fd99d04926f1a25ca9a9ea643ce891c
1 Input
1 Output
-
51608792ad2154ea62c07582cb596e9a7fd99d04926f1a25ca9a9ea643ce891c:0
- value
- 711462
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e10b9cb1f8be437c9e96cf8894694386e8d5e0f
- address
- bc1qpcgtnjcl30jr0j0fdnugj3558phg6hs0505w6j